Action item from the Larkspur Marathon incident review: the timing-chip reader at the 30km mat dropped roughly 40 seconds of reads when its buffer filled during the peak runner wave. We're adding a watchdog that flushes the buffer every 5 seconds and pages us if reads stall. Owner is Teodric, due before the Fennwick Half next quarter. Please don't close this until the watchdog has run clean through a full race simulation. Test procedure and sign-off checklist live here.

runbook for taduf-kawef: https://confluence.qorvelsys.internal/projects/display/display/pages

When surveyors report queued submissions stuck after reconnecting, first verify the sync daemon is running on the device gateway. The daemon replays the local journal in order; do not clear the journal manually, as that discards unsent observations permanently. If the daemon logs an authentication failure, the gateway's env file has likely been regenerated without the upload credential. Rebuild the env file from the maintained template, then append the upload credential on the next line.

secret setting of hawep-yahig: LEDGER_TOKEN29=41b5d6315371c92885eaeb077fb63

Subject: ChipGate reader firmware ready for sign-off

Team, the Velomark ChipGate reader build for the Harrowfield Marathon is staged. We corrected the antenna polling interval so split-mat reads no longer drop below 98.5% under peak density, and verified clock sync against the Torsten course controller in three cold-start cycles. Packaging checksums matched on both staging mirrors. Please hold distribution until Marit confirms the battery telemetry regression is closed. The exact build under review is identified below.

session token of hawif-bajog = htk6_9ab8da